Vision Statement

Focusing on the Unreached
The future of OM will be shaped by a sharpened focus upon the peoples of the Muslim, Hindu and Buddhist worlds and those in secular and nominally religious Europe. We will send an increasing number of fully supported, long-term workers into these areas to achieve measurable goals in evangelism and church planting. Where appropriate, OM teams will combine evangelism and compassionate outreach to those in physical need. Short-term outreaches will continue and even increase as an integral part of our long-range strategy.

Partnering with Churches
We will mobilize prayer and missions involvement in the global Body of Christ. Our commitment is to active partnership and networking with churches and other ministries both at home and on the field of service. We recognize that ongoing spiritual renewal will be required in ourselves and in the church as we stand for Biblical faith in a changing world.

Caring for our Members
OM wants to be a welcoming and caring fellowship. Pastoral care, mentoring, and regular appraisal will be provided for every member. Where appropriate, counseling and career planning will also be provided.

Training and Equipping World Christians
We are committed to life-long learning at every level in the organization. An effective training program with a common core curriculum will be provided for all trainees. Specialist training for evangelism, church planting and leadership will also be provided.

Mobilizing the Next Generation
To mobilize a new generation of senders and cross-cultural workers, we will train and commission increasing numbers of gifted individuals who will involve intercessors, enlist recruits and raise funds. At the same time, an important aspect of our strategy is to encourage many OM graduates to join other mission agencies.

Globalizing the Ministry
We will go beyond being just international, striving for a truly multinational and transcultural partnership. This will enable each of our national entities to make a significant contribution to the movement in planning, decision- making, strategizing and implementation. Internationally, any one country or culture will not dominate us. Nationally, we will strive for substantial indigenization in the leadership. Our vision is greater interdependence, multi-racial affirmation and sharing of resources in the accomplishment of our mission.

Strengthening the Organization
The organization wants to empower our leaders to better serve those they lead. We will refine and adapt our organizational structures to increase our ministry effectiveness.
